Dallas, TX Clearance Level: Active Do D Secret Clearance Summary/Description: Warehouse specialist with active Secret clearance required to support QED's government client with warehouse, inventory control, and shipping and receiving tasks. Specific tasks may include, but not be limited to: Load and unload shipments Inspect received materials for damage.

Shipment quantities must be verified and checked Verify shipment quantities and inspect for visual damage. Verify equipment serial number and applicable barcodes match shipping documents and confirm item quantities on the delivery receipt before accepting the shipment Ensure damaged property is put in a designated location and identified

for disposition instructions Record each asset received or shipped via digital photograph Update property management system inventory records File all signed original documents by date received or shipped prepare property for shipping Pick the identified property from its designated location Stage property in a designated location Package property using the appropriate packaging and labeling standards Load property onto scheduled carrier's vehicle(s) Properly dispose of all packaging materials/debris weekly Required Education, Skills and Qualifications: Active Do D Secret security clearance Three years or more working in a warehouse environment Excellent verbal and written communication skills

Computer experience, including entering data into inventory databases About Us: QED Enterprises, Inc.
